Sevenoaks Town Council awarded £20,000 grant for solar batteries at Bat & Ball Centre

Sevenoaks Town Council is pleased to announce we have secured a £20,000 grant from the West Kent Rural Grant Scheme and Rural England Prosperity Fund to support the installation of solar batteries at the Bat & Ball Centre.


Although solar panels were installed during the Bat & Ball Centre’s construction, funding for accompanying solar batteries was not available at the time. This new grant will now enable the installation of this vital energy storage technology.

The Bat & Ball Centre is a modern, multi-use community facility owned by the Town Council. The building underwent a major refurbishment, completed in 2020, replacing the outdated 1970s Sevenoaks Community Centre with a vibrant community hub that supports a diverse mix of daytime and evening activities. Open year-round, it hosts events including weddings, meetings, conferences, and classes.

The total cost of the solar battery project is £40,000. The remaining £20,000 will be funded through the Town Council’s Community Infrastructure Levy (CIL) income, which is paid by developers to support local improvements.

The solar batteries will store excess energy produced from the solar panels and make use of cheaper overnight tariffs. This will significantly enhance the building’s energy efficiency and sustainability.

This initiative is part of Sevenoaks Town Council’s Green Community Investment Plan, demonstrating our continued commitment to environmentally responsible projects that benefit the local area.

Councillor Claire Shea, Leader of Sevenoaks Town Council, commented, ‘We are delighted to be able to make our community centre even more energy efficient, and to make good use of renewables. Our Town Council is determined to reduce our impact on the environment and to support residents to do the same. We need to be resilient to the changing climate and energy demands, and we are pleased to move a step forward with our modernised centre at Bat and Ball’.
